Etymology[edit]
From Alaskan + Athabaskan words meaning “little dog”.
Noun[edit]
Alaskan Klee Kai (plural Alaskan Klee Kais)
- A spitz-type breed of dog, developed in the late 20th century as a companion-sized dog resembling the larger Alaskan Husky and Siberian Husky.
- Synonym: AKK
